Paul Wade diagnosed with probable CTE

Paul Wade, a former Socceroos captain, has disclosed a probable diagnosis of chronic traumatic encephalopathy after an earlier suspected diagnosis in 2024, using his disclosure to raise awareness of concussion and long-term brain health in football. Neurologists and experts, including Rowena Mobbs, are urging tighter concussion policies and a reduction in heading for youth players, with Wade’s case echoing broader calls in Australia for better player protection and support systems.

Boy Harsher sign to Atlantic, announce Get Mean

Boy Harsher announce their major-label debut GET MEAN, due September 18 on Atlantic, alongside the self-directed video for the single Hard Beat that threads themes of surveillance, trauma, grief, and renewal as the duo moves through a painful breakup and personal loss. Recorded across eight locations in the US, Mexico, and Italy, the album is described as a redemption project built from the most intense period of their lives, followed by a North American tour.
